Spring Maintenance Tasks
1. Inspect Hardware
As winter thaws, it's time to check the hardware of your garage door. Look for rusted or damaged components, and tighten any loose screws or bolts.
- Check the springs for wear.
- Examine the rollers and hinges for proper functioning.
- Inspect cables for fraying or wear.
2. Clean and Lubricate
Spring cleaning isn't just for your home—your garage door needs attention too. Cleaning and lubrication ensure smooth operation:
- Use a damp cloth to wipe down the garage door surface.
- Apply a silicone-based lubricant to springs, rollers, and hinges.
- Do not spray lubricant directly on the tracks; instead, clean them with a dry cloth.
Summer Maintenance Tips
1. Check Weatherstripping
Hot summer temperatures can cause weatherstripping to crack and wear. Check the sealing around your garage door:
- Ensure the weatherstripping forms a tight seal.
- Replace any damaged sections to improve energy efficiency.
2. Test the Safety Features
Every garage door should have safety features, such as auto-reverse mechanisms. Testing these features is crucial:
- Place a small object in the door's path and close it.
- The door should automatically reverse upon contact.
Autumn Preparation
1. Clear Debris from Tracks
As autumn leaves fall, they can clog your garage door tracks. To prevent operational issues, regularly check and clear debris:
- Use a soft brush to remove dirt and leaves from the tracks.
- Ensure the tracks are aligned properly.
2. Inspect Sensors
Garage door sensors can become misaligned or dirty due to seasonal changes. Clean the sensors with a soft cloth and ensure they're aligned:
- Check that the indicator lights are functioning.
- Realign misaligned sensors if needed.
Winter Readiness
1. Ensure Proper Insulation
Winter can be harsh in Bellevue, WA. Proper insulation keeps your garage warm and energy-efficient:
- Inspect the door's insulation for any gaps or damages.
- Consider adding insulation panels if needed.
2. Test Door Balance
A properly balanced door ensures smooth operation and prolongs the life of your garage door system:
- Disconnect the opener by pulling the release handle.
- Manually lift the door halfway. It should stay in place. If it falls or rises, it may need adjustment.
